Output 826d52eb95c059e3dffa2fbe4f444812ee252a78d2c934646d72df69ebcd4e5e:3

value
85118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db050a60988218220709d3398890e3e95cbe10e4 OP_EQUAL
address
3Mf5wn2qxpaP2484fDKsajVucNfhQq35ba
transaction
826d52eb95c059e3dffa2fbe4f444812ee252a78d2c934646d72df69ebcd4e5e
confirmations
49986
spent
true